What We Bring to Site

Commercial-Grade Equipment, Not Rental-Store Fans

Our Brookshire trucks carry the same class of equipment used on large commercial losses: truck-mounted extraction units, low-grain-refrigerant dehumidifiers, high-velocity air movers, and moisture meters capable of reading behind walls without cutting into them.

That equipment difference matters. A rental-store fan moves air across a surface; our dehumidification setup actively pulls moisture out of the air and out of building materials, cutting drying time from weeks down to days in most Brookshire jobs.

Why Call a Pro

The Hidden Risk of Handling Water Damage Yourself

A shop vac and a few fans can make a Brookshire property look dry on the surface — but "looks dry" and "is actually dry" are two very different things.

The visible water on your Brookshire floor is often only part of the problem. Water wicks upward into drywall, travels along subfloor seams, and pools inside wall cavities where a rented fan will never reach it. Without professional-grade dehumidification and moisture monitoring, that hidden dampness can sit for weeks, quietly feeding mold growth long after the surface looks and feels dry to the touch.

Insurance carriers generally want to see documented proof that a water loss was properly mitigated. A DIY cleanup rarely produces that kind of record, which can leave Brookshire homeowners exposed if related damage — like mold or warped subfloor — shows up months later and the carrier questions whether it was handled correctly the first time.

None of this means every spill needs a professional crew — a small, contained, surface-level spill that's dried within a few hours is usually fine to handle yourself. But once water has soaked into flooring, baseboards, or drywall, or if it's been sitting for more than a few hours, it's worth a call to make sure nothing's hiding beneath the surface.

Safety First

What To Do While You Wait For Our Brookshire Crew

The minutes before our Brookshire crew arrives matter. Here's what our dispatchers typically recommend, situation permitting.

1

Stop the Source if Safe

If the water is coming from a pipe, appliance, or fixture you can safely reach, shut off the supply valve or main.

2

Stay Clear of Outlets

Never touch electrical switches, outlets, or appliances that are wet or near standing water — the risk of shock is real.

3

Move Valuables to Dry Ground

Lifting rugs, moving boxes, and relocating valuables can reduce secondary damage while you wait for our team.

4

Document the Damage

Snap photos or video of the affected areas before anything is moved — this helps your insurance claim later.

5

Ventilate If Possible

If weather allows, opening windows or doors can help slow humidity buildup until our Brookshire team arrives with drying equipment.
